HAMAN v. COMMISSIONER

Docket No. 3169-70.

31 T.C.M. 466 (1972)

T.C. Memo. 1972-118

Richard Haman and Beverly Haman v. Commissioner.

United States Tax Court.

Filed May 22, 1972.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Richard Haman and Beverly Haman, pro se, 210 Sunnybrook Dr., Fortuna, Calif. Harry M. Asch and Joyce E. Britt, for the respondent.


Memorandum Findings of Fact and Opinion

FEATHERSTON, Judge:

Respondent determined deficiencies in petitioners' Federal income taxes for 1966 and 1967 in the amounts of $2,646.32 and $3,930.75, respectively, and additions to such taxes under section 6653(a)1 in the amounts of $132.31 and $196.53, respectively. The issues for decision are:
